-4/3x + 2/5x = 14/45 get the common denominator of 45 on the left
(-60/45)x + (18/45)x = 14/45 multiply through by 45
-60x + 18x = 14 combine like terms
-42x = 14 divide by -42 on both sides
x = 14 / -42 = -1 / 3

$$66\frac{2}{3}%$$% of 96
$$=\frac{66\frac{2}{3}}{100}\times{96}$$
$$=\frac{2}{3}\times{96}$$
$$=64$$
